Output 28803a55bdb83a85101e978d0d3b8c961c376290009181822a1f16e2180b5ed0:1

value
1541918910
script pubkey
OP_0 OP_PUSHBYTES_20 ed3d4081ce2ebbc790f8e15e5e6115bda985600e
address
ltc1qa575pqww96au0y8cu909ucg4hk5c2cqw2alxvw
transaction
28803a55bdb83a85101e978d0d3b8c961c376290009181822a1f16e2180b5ed0
spent
true